This book deals not just with urgent outward shame, but rather its inwardness. The author examines how these internal conflicts of shame are reflected in all relationships. He focuses on the following issues: the "negative therapeutic reaction", the "evil eye", the dynamics of envy and jealousy and their roots in the emotions of shame, lies and betrayal. He also discusses the origins of the formation of conscience and the dichotomy of the "inner judge" and its various sides.
Autoren-Porträt von Léon Wurmser
Prof. Dr. Léon Wurmser enjoys an international reputation as a Psychiatrist and Psychoanalyst. He works in his own private practice in Towson, Maryland, and also as an Educational Analyst and Supervisor at the New York Freudian Society.
